You might feel some pain for a while when your dental braces are initially placed on and when they are adjusted. It will take a little time to get made use of to your braces and they can trouble your lips and cheeks. If this takes place, an alleviation wax can be applied to your braces.


It is essential to clean your braces along with the front, back and chewing surface areas of the teeth. Your dentist or orthodontist will certainly provide you tips on how to clean and on exactly how to floss making use of floss threaders. After flossing, roll it up in a little sphere and placed it in the waste.

If you have dental braces, do not bite on hard things such as ice cubes and nuts. Do not eat the ends of pens or pencils


Problems that are not dealt with can cause the therapy to last longer. Todays braces are smaller and less visible. Besides the traditional steel braces, there are tooth-coloured ceramic braces that are less obvious. Clear aligners are also readily available for grownups. Braces and elastics can likewise be multicoloured. Talk with your dental expert or orthodontist concerning all your choices.

There are various sorts of headgear and they may be put on throughout any type of part of the orthodontic therapy. Your orthodontist or dental practitioner will certainly reveal you exactly how to place on the headwear and inform you the length of time to use it daily


They might require to be used regularly or part of the time. Tooth removal might be required if your teeth are crowded or if a tooth is severely out of setting. Jaw surgery (or orthognathic surgery) might be required when there are significant differences in the size or setting of the top and reduced jaws.

An orthodontist is a dental expert trained to detect, protect additional reading against, and deal with teeth and jaw abnormalities. They correct existing conditions and are educated to determine troubles that may establish in the future. Orthodontists work with individuals of any ages, from youngsters to adults. People typically connect a perfect smile with excellent health.


All orthodontists are dental experts, yet not all dental practitioners are orthodontists. Orthodontic residency programs use intensive, concentrated instruction for try this web-site dental professionals. They concentrate on 2 locations: Just how to properly and securely move teeth How to correctly guide development in the teeth, jaw, and faceOnce an orthodontist has actually finished training, they have the choice to end up being board certified.

During your initial orthodontic appointment, you'll likely have: A dental examPhotos taken of your face and smileDental X-raysPanoramic (360 level) X-rays of your face and headImpressions to create mold and mildews of your teethThese tests will help your orthodontist recognize how to wage your therapy. An orthodontist is a dental professional that's had training to treat your teeth and jaw.


An orthodontist is concentrated on your bite, so something like a damaged tooth would certainly be handled by a dentist. Orthodontists are focused on your bite, or the method your teeth fit together, and the straightness of your teeth.
